US issues travel warning for Oman over drone, missile threats

Filed: Sep 02, 2026 at 5:05 PM ET
Summary: The U.S. State Department warned Americans against travel to Oman, citing risks from terrorism and attacks involving drones and missiles. The warning links the threat to Iran, according to the description of the advisory.
WHO: U.S. State Department
WHAT: Issued a travel warning advising Americans not to visit Oman due to terrorism and drone/missile attack risks attributed to Iran.
WHEN: Sep 02, 2026 at 4:50 PM ET
WHERE: Oman
WHY: The warning was triggered by concerns about terrorism and drone and missile attacks from Iran.
